The GE RPWFE filter is built for select GE French-door refrigerators, delivering premium filtration. It is certified to reduce chlorine-resistant cysts, lead, and 50+ impurities, with a notable emphasis on reducing pharmaceuticals. The filter supports a six-month replacement cadence and highlights the reduction of a range of pharmaceutical compounds such as ibuprofen, progesterone, atenolol, trimethoprim, and fluoxetine. This makes it a versatile choice for households seeking broad impurity reduction alongside lead and pharmaceutical concerns.

Buying Guide

Key purchase considerations

Selecting the right refrigerator water filter depends on fit, filtration needs, and maintenance. Start by confirming compatibility with your fridge model, then evaluate what you want filtered from your water and ice. Many filters target lead, chlorine by-products, pesticides, and pharmaceuticals. NSF/ANSI certifications (such as 42, 53, and 401) indicate tested performance for taste, odor, and contaminant reduction. Consider how often you’ll replace the filter, as six-month intervals are common but usage can vary. Finally, compare total cost and availability to ensure a steady supply of replacement filters.

Filtration standards and what they mean

NSF/ANSI 42 covers aesthetic improvements like taste and odor, while 53 focuses on specific contaminants, including metals and chemicals. NSF 401 addresses emerging contaminants not always found in water, such as certain pharmaceuticals. When shopping, notes like “pharmaceutical reduction” or “50+ impurities” indicate broader filtration scopes. Filters designed for popular brands often come with guaranteed fit and easier installation, reducing the risk of leaks or improper seating. Understanding these standards helps you prioritize filters that align with your water quality goals.
